This place is special. Chef Mike combines Contemporary western food with Chinese classics and the results are undoubtedly the best food we experienced in Bali. We started with the Smoked Bacon Sliders and Pork Dumplings. The dumplings were delicious - beautifully cooked, drizzled in a light sauce, and accompanied with crunchy fried shallots and fresh spring onion. The Smoked Bacon Sliders were the star of the whole show - bursting with smoky flavour and encased in perfectly cooked buns. We shared a bowl of Beef Noodles - expertly cooked pieces of tender beef, a thick and flavoursome broth, a whole egg (boiled to perfection in the broth), plenty of noodles. This was accompanied with a jar of sauce made on site - nothing but smoked chilis and fresh chilis, blended to a puree. Mike recommended just a couple of drops of this rocket fuel to spice up the noodles, so that is what we did. It added a pleasant heat without taking over the dish. Two starters and a main were plenty for two people, thanks to the generous portions, but Mike asked if we wanted dessert and given the experience to that point, we were powerless to say no. The dessert option (there's just one) is Handmade vanilla ice cream, strawberry jam, fresh cream and meringue. It was, like everything else, perfect. We will be...

one of my favorite places in Bali! If you like asian/chinese cuisine: THIS is the place for AMAZING food.

Went there multiple times and always blown away by the flavor.

Want some examples?

The lamb noodles - never had such nice, chewy, fragrant, earthy noodles with such a distinct flavor profile.

Cucumber kimchi - unbelievable refreshing, nice, crunchy kimchi. Perfect side dish.

Pork belly rice - so, so, SO good! The pork is soft and succulent and crunchy and the right kind of fatty. Just perfect and a must-try! I dare you.

And I really really hope, that they will add the chicken pâté back on the menu. And so should you, because it’s an eye opener! With the chives and the hot oil on the warm flatbread... an absolute delight!

The interior is pretty cool too, but nothing too fancy (so you can concentrate on the food!).

I do like that the kitchen is open so if you want, you can take a seat at the counter and watch your food getting cooked.

Also you can read some of the books displayed while you wait. My secret tip: Momofuku is more than just a cookbook. It’s a thriller!

Or have a chat with the super friendly owner of this place.

I can’t wait for my next visit and hope you will enjoy this hidden gem of Bali’s restaurant scenery...

We were craving ramen for dinner last night, so we decided to search for a few places on Google. This spot came up with great reviews, so we gave it a try. When we arrived, the place was nearly empty, with just one other table occupied, which surprised us a bit. We ordered the beef noodle soup and the dry beef noodles, and both dishes were absolutely delicious. The meat was incredibly tender, practically melting in our mouths, and the broth was rich, flavorful, and aromatic. Even my 4-year-old daughter loved it, which says a lot! That said, I do have a couple of suggestions: it would be great if they offered more dumpling filling options beyond pork, to cater to those who don’t eat it. Also, they only accept cash, which was a bit inconvenient for me since I had to take a quick motorbike trip to the nearest ATM to settle the bill. Overall, though, this is a fantastic spot to satisfy your noodle cravings! We thoroughly enjoyed our meal, and we’ll definitely be back for more.

This was a superbe discovery! This place exists for a very long time. But from outside you can’t see if there are people or not inside. This is because the tables are upstairs! There is nothing we dislike more them an empty restaurant! So, not knowing the tables were upstairs, we always past it. Oh! but what a mistake! We were missing on Mike’s fantastic food. ❤️Wow! Mike is the owner and he welcomes you. At first he can seems a bit unwelcoming! I think he is a shy man! But at the end of the meal, we spoke to him and he is a great restaurant owner with great values. (But a smile would make such a better first impression on new comers 😉) Anyway we weren’t there for Mike but for is food that was absolutely FANTASTIC! The dumplings were mouth watering ! I loooove the Dandan noodles more but my bf love the rice Claypot more. Seriously everything is delicious! The awesome flavors, and the crispy rice from the clay pot! Miammm Don’t miss Xiahouse!

I was curious with new Chinese food place opened in renon area. They have unique menus. One is on promo (set menu with rice & drink for 60k). It's 3 pcs of pork ribs, 3 pcs of meat balls served inside broth from soy milk base. The broth taste is rich yet light, not oily at all. Meatballs taste great, pork ribs basically melted off the bones. Using cilantro instead of celery add unique flavor. No doubt this made with exquisite techniques and great care. However I am worried because there's plenty of competition in denpasar area, especially lots of legendary Chinese cuisine establishment around. This place is small, more like place for youngsters looking for humble place to dine out. But the price and menu doesn't match that demografic. If the place a little bit fancier it might fit the whole vibe. Probably touristy area like canggu or sanur will be more suitable. However while it's here in renon, I suggest everyone to try their food.
